All About

PartitionRecovery is freeware and written by TOKIWA to recover the partition deleted accidentally, which means it can restore the files and folders in the deleted partition.
Compatible operating systems

    * Windows2000/XP/Vista

Key-features

    * NTFS and FAT32 supported
    * simple and instructive UI
    * neither installation nor DLLs is needed
    * Windows Vista supported

How to use

You can understand it intuitively through simple UI and balloon tips. So there is no need for instructions. Also you can update PartitionRecovery to new version if available through "Version info" of system menu.
Notice

    * If it says "Could not find boot sector!", important information to recover partition is already overwritten or lost. So use another tool.
    * In case you can not open the recovered partition due to unformatted or something, use "Delete partition" button to wipe the unsuccessfully recovered partition and try again.

Install/Un-install

    * PartitionRecovery doesn't need to be installed. Just unpack the archive you downloaded and it's runnable.
    * PartitionRecovery doesn't install anything, so no registry entries or initialization files are left on your computer when you delete the directory of PartitionRecovery.
